Strategies Discussed on Reddit for Managing Personal Debt
Many Reddit threads focus on personal debt management strategies, even though they may not directly address national debt. Common strategies discussed include creating a budget, prioritizing debt payments (like the debt snowball or avalanche method), negotiating with creditors, and exploring debt consolidation options.
These strategies, while effective for personal debt, do not directly address the broader issue of national debt. However, understanding how individuals manage their personal finances offers valuable insights into the challenges and potential solutions at a larger scale.
